Wyeth's Dialysed Iron.

(FERRUM DIALYSATUM.)

A Pure Neutral Solution of Oxide of Iron in the Colloid Form. and Diffusion with Distilled Water.

[merged small][merged small][ocr errors]

The Result of Endosmosis

PHILADELPHIA.

This article possesses great advantages over every other ferruginous preparation heretofore introduced, as it is a solution of Iron in as nearly as possible the form in which it exists in the blood. It is a preparation of invariable strength and purity, obtained by a process of dialysation, the Iron being separated from its combinations by endosmosis, according to the law of diffusion of liquids. It has no styptic taste, does not blacken the teeth, disturb the stomach or constipate the bowels.

It affords, therefore, the very best mode of administering Iron in cases where the use of this emedy is indicated. In ordering, please specify WYETH'S.

This school was founded by members of the Post-Graduate Faculty of the University of the City of New York, and was the first institution in the United States to present a systematic system of clinical instruction for graduates in medicine. All the Lectures are Clinical. It is a place of instruction, in which the practitioner, by actually handling the cases under the guidance of the Professors and Instructors, may learn the use of instruments for examination and treatment and observe the effects of remedies.

Its facilities are unrivalled. Each hospital to which the teachers are attached forms a part of the field of instruction. The general schedule is so arranged that there is no conflict in the hours of attendance of the professors. The clinics begin at 9 A.M., and continue until 9 P.M., each day; and the Clinical Society of the School meets twice a month on Saturday evenings. A Dispensary and a Hospital form a part of the school, with one ward exclusively for infants, which has been lately endowed by benevolent ladies of New York City. Dr. JOSEPH O'DWYER, the inventor of INTUBATION OF THE LARYNX, gives practical instruction to classes organized in this School, and only here. Professor ABRAHAM JACOBI, of the College of Physicians and Surgeons, holds a weekly Clinic of Diseases of Children in this School.

THE VITAL PRINCIPLES OF BEEF CONCENTRATED.

A HIGHLY-CONDENSED RAW FOOD EXTRACT.

In Typhoid Fever the pathological conditions present in the large and small intestine about the ileo-cocal valve from the inflammation and suppuration of the agminated and solitary glands demand a food containing no excrementitious matter, while the depressing effects of the disease upon the vital powers through the nervous system make a highly nutritious and stimulating food absolutely necessary.

These indications for a food are met in Bovinine, which contains all the albuminoids of Beef and Mutton in a very concentrated form, unchanged by heat or chemicals, as well as its stimulating meat salts.

In all cases where rectal alimentation is necessary, no more eligible food preparation can be found than Bovinine. Reports of several cases are at hand showing increase of strength and weight in patients nourished for weeks upon Bovinine exclusively, administered in this manner.

In disturbances of the intestinal tract accompanied by gastric irritation; in cancer of the stomach or rectum; in supplying the waste of albuminuria; in the marasmus of infancy or old age; in scrofulous conditions; in phthisis, and in so-called dyspeptic conditions, Bovinine will be found of signal service, securing better nutrition and assimilation, and alleviating the conditions present. Bovinine is a raw food and is neither partially or wholly predigested, so that when given in cases of enfeebled digestive powers, it does not still further increase the inability of the gastric forces to perform their work, but restores them by its physiological stimulation to their normal effectiveness.
